Franchisee Opt-Out 2025: Skipping Disclosure and Cooling-Off Periods

Posted by Elizabeth Gore-Jones on 13 March 2025
Under the updated franchise regulations effective in 2025, franchisees renewing or extending agreements can opt out of receiving disclosure documents and cooling-off periods. This change benefits both franchisors and franchisees by reducing delays. Key Facts Sheet Removal 2025: A Win for Franchisors

Posted by Elizabeth Gore-Jones on 13 March 2025
Franchisors rejoice: the Key Facts Sheet is gone!Hallelujah! As of 1 April 2025, the Key Facts Sheet is officially gone.
